The revamped flow replaces emailed tokens with short-lived signed links minted by the Keythorn service. For a security review, note: links expire in ten minutes, are single-use, and bind to the requesting device fingerprint. If Keythorn itself is unreachable, operators fall back to the manual recovery console in the Bridgeport cluster. That console requires two on-call approvals plus the standing recovery passphrase held by the identity team, reproduced for reviewers immediately below this line.

unlock words, yawig-kagef: gordor-holvan-ulaael-pramir-ulaiel-tamdor

// Heads up, support folks: this constant caps how many vehicles the
// weekly fuel-usage report pulls from the Haulwick fleet service in one
// batch. If a customer says their report is missing trucks, it's almost
// always because their fleet is bigger than this cap and pagination
// kicked in. Don't bump it without checking with the Roadledger team
// first — the export job gets slow fast. When escalating, grab the
// report's generation stamp from the footer and paste the token below.

session token of tajef-bageg = htk21_5d90d574934f3ccae6437

## Runbook: Flagmere rollout framework

Support scope: Flagmere controls staged feature rollouts. Customers reporting missing features are usually in a cohort not yet ramped — check the rollout percentage before escalating. Do not toggle flags yourself; file a ramp request. Kill switch reverts all flags to baseline within 60 seconds. Stale-cache symptoms clear after one client restart. Escalate only if baseline itself misbehaves. The framework's evaluator currently runs with the following configuration values.

service settings:
[casax]
port = 6379
team = rusir
host = casax.zemvarhq.corp
region = outer-4
access_code = ac_9808ce
timeout_ms = 1500

TURN-208: Gatevale turnstile counters at the Merrow Field pilot double-count when a rotation reverses mid-cycle. Attendance totals drift roughly 2% high per event. The debounce window fix is implemented, reviewed by Ilsa, and soak-tested across two simulated match days without drift. Ready for your cut; the candidate build is identified below.

trace token, tagag-tafog: htk6_5ed18c